    Summary: The paper proposes a new switched control design method for some classes of uncertain nonlinear plants described by Takagi-Sugeno fuzzy models. This method uses a quadratic Lyapunov function to design the feedback controller gains based on linear matrix inequalities (LMIs). The controller gain is chosen by a switching law that returns the smallest value of the time derivative of the Lyapunov function. The proposed methodology eliminates the need to find the membership function expressions to implement the control laws. The control designs of a ball-and-beam system and of a magnetic levitator illustrate the procedure.
